What this result means

Compute ∫ₐᵇ f(x) dx for polynomials using Simpson's rule. ∫ₐᵇ f(x)dx = F(b) − F(a) where F′ = f.

Assumptions

  • Rule dependency: Universal formula.

FTC

∫ₐᵇ f(x)dx = F(b) − F(a) where F′ = f.

Example

∫₀² x² dx = 8/3 ≈ 2.667.
